本文简要介绍 python 语言中 scipy.special.factorial2
的用法。
用法:
scipy.special.factorial2(n, exact=False)#
双阶乘。
这是每秒钟跳过一次值的阶乘。例如,
7!! = 7 * 5 * 3 * 1
。它可以在数值上近似为:n!! = 2 ** (n / 2) * gamma(n / 2 + 1) * sqrt(2 / pi) n odd = 2 ** (n / 2) * gamma(n / 2 + 1) n even = 2 ** (n / 2) * (n / 2)! n even
- n: int 或 数组
计算
n!!
。如果n < 0
,返回值为0。- exact: 布尔型,可选
结果可以使用上面的gamma-formula(默认)快速近似。如果精确设置为真,则使用整数算术精确计算答案。
- nff: 浮点数或int
n 的双阶乘,作为 int 或浮点数,具体取决于精确值。
参数 ::
返回 ::
例子:
>>> from scipy.special import factorial2 >>> factorial2(7, exact=False) array(105.00000000000001) >>> factorial2(7, exact=True) 105
相关用法
- Python SciPy special.factorial用法及代码示例
- Python SciPy special.factorialk用法及代码示例
- Python SciPy special.fdtridfd用法及代码示例
- Python SciPy special.fdtrc用法及代码示例
- Python SciPy special.fresnel用法及代码示例
- Python SciPy special.fdtr用法及代码示例
- Python SciPy special.fdtri用法及代码示例
- Python SciPy special.exp1用法及代码示例
- Python SciPy special.expn用法及代码示例
- Python SciPy special.ncfdtri用法及代码示例
- Python SciPy special.gamma用法及代码示例
- Python SciPy special.y1用法及代码示例
- Python SciPy special.y0用法及代码示例
- Python SciPy special.ellip_harm_2用法及代码示例
- Python SciPy special.i1e用法及代码示例
- Python SciPy special.smirnovi用法及代码示例
- Python SciPy special.ker用法及代码示例
- Python SciPy special.ynp_zeros用法及代码示例
- Python SciPy special.k0e用法及代码示例
- Python SciPy special.j1用法及代码示例
- Python SciPy special.logsumexp用法及代码示例
- Python SciPy special.expit用法及代码示例
- Python SciPy special.polygamma用法及代码示例
- Python SciPy special.nbdtrik用法及代码示例
- Python SciPy special.nbdtrin用法及代码示例
注:本文由纯净天空筛选整理自scipy.org大神的英文原创作品 scipy.special.factorial2。非经特殊声明,原始代码版权归原作者所有,本译文未经允许或授权,请勿转载或复制。